Configure the network addressing parameters
To configure the network addressing parameters:
1. On the
XBee Configuration
page in the XBee Industrial Gateway web interface, in the
Remote
XBee Devices
list, click a node under
Remote XBee Devices
. The XBee Configuration settings
for the node appear.
2. Click
Addressing Settings
.
3. In the
Destination Address (DH/DL)
field, set the destination address for the data to be sent
from the node.
4. Under
ZigBee Addressing
, set the
ZigBee Destination Endpoint (DE)
to
0xe8
and set the
ZigBee Cluster ID (CI)
parameter to
0x11.
5. Click
Apply
to save your changes.
Explore serial I/O
If you want your XBee nodes to send data over a serial line, you must configure the XBee nodes for
your ZigBee network to transmit serial data.

Understanding the process for configuring the serial I/O
The process for configuring the serial I/O requires that you:
1. Assess the device hardware connected to the XBee nodes. What kind of equipment is it? What
type of information is it measuring, collecting, and transmitting?
This assessment will help you identify the I/O connections and pins needed, and later to set
serial I/O parameters appropriate for the attached hardware.
2. Understand what must be configured for the XBee module on the XBee nodes and attached
hardware to work with the XBee Industrial Gateway Python application.
XBee RF modules have many parameters. In many cases, the default setting for a parameter is
sufficient. For successful serial transmission of data from XBee nodes and use with the XBee
Industrial Gateway Python application, the
Serial settings
for the XBee node must match the
serial settings for the device attached to the XBee serial port that you are configuring.
3. Configure XBee serial parameters.
